FÉDÉRATION FRANÇAISE DE ROLLER SKATEBOARD

Skateboarding

The sports department has recognized skate as a sport discipline since the mid s. Since 1997, skateboard is connected to the French roller-skating federation, now known as the French roller sports federation. This recognition of skate allowed the creation of diplomas, the organisation of an official French championship and the creation of a technical and sporting regulation with the recognition of the specialities street, ramp, bowl and descent.

UNION BORDEAUX-BÈGLES

Rugby

In 2006, Stade Bordelais (Pro D2) and Club Athlétique Béglais (Fédérale 1), which won two French Championship titles in 1969 and 1991, merged to form Union Stade Bordeaux CA Bordelais Bègles. Under the impetus of its new president, Laurent Marti, the club became Union Bordeaux Bègles (UBB) in May 2008, in order to offer a great club to our rugby land. After years in Pro D2 (2006-2011), spurred on by an all-consuming enthusiasm, almost flawless talent and a passionate public, UBB made its return to the Top 14. By the end of the 2014-2015 season, UBB had overtaken the legendary English club Saracens to become, no less, the biggest crowd in Europe, with an average of 27,000 fans per match. For the first time in its history, UBB qualifies for the European Rugby Champions Cup for the 2015-2016 season. Renowned for its resolutely attacking game, Union Bordeaux Bègles continues to progress, attracting some of the biggest names in world rugby, including Australians Adam Ashley-Cooper and Sekope Kepu, former Auckland Blues captain Luke Braid, and French internationals Sofiane Guitoune, Lionel Beauxis, Jean-Marcellin Buttin and Loann Goujon. According to the rankings initiated by the Ligue Nationale de Rugby in January 2019, Union Bordeaux Bègles has the second-best French training center among Top 14 clubs. Created in 1999, the UBB Training Center is located within the Stade André Moga (in Bègles, of course).

LOU BATEL'EYRE

Boat and pedalo hire

You can discover the Leyre and its delta without tiring yourself out on a boat called a Galupe. This flat-bottomed boat, once used to transport goods by river in the Landes region, is steered by a boatman using oars and paddles to preserve nature. This guided tour, interpreted and supervised by Guillaume and Yannick, is open to all. Depending on the tides, you'll discover wilderness areas. You can observe the flora and fauna of this river, nicknamed the Little Amazon for its amber color due to iron hydroxide.

OBSERVATOIRE DE BORDEAUX

Astronomy

This beautiful observatory, founded in 1878 and listed as a Historic Monument in 2010, offers tours organized by the Sirius association, Bordeaux Métropole, the University of Bordeaux and the town of Floirac. These guided tours enable visitors to admire the large equatorial telescope with its 7m-long tube! You'll also learn about the rich history of the site and discover the work of British artist Suzanne Treister, installed in the large dome. Beware: you'll need to be able to climb the staircase, which is not suitable for young children or people with reduced mobility.

BALADE DES POLDERS

Hiking

The polders, or "mattes" as they are known locally, are lands reclaimed from the sea and drained according to a very particular method, initiated by Dutch engineers who came to practice their art at the request of Louis XIV. Stretching from Valeyrac to the Verdon, these large expanses are crossed by tamarisk hedges and drainage ditches. To explore them, start at the Richard lighthouse, then walk inland along the estuary's shoreline at the Richard port. Continue to the D2 road and take one of the trails back to the lighthouse.
